A more than a year the authors of Cesky Sen (Czech dream) Vit Klusak and Filip Remunda have been shooting a document Cesky mir (Czech peace). The film depicts ‘Czech radar struggle’ and will be screened this spring.
The duo focus on specific Czech stupidity. If you haven’t seen the movie Cesky sen, it is simply about amount, at which consuming replaced religion in Czechs. They made a fictive hypermarket Cesky sen, with advertisements, with billboards, TV campaign. Thousands of people have gathered at the ceremonial opening, only to find out it was a hoax. Some wanted to kill them.

On June 12, 1987, President Ronald Reagan spoke the people of West Berlin at the base of the Brandenburg Gate, near the Berlin wall. Due to the amplification system being used, the President’s words could also be heard on the Eastern (Communist-controlled) side of the wall. The address Reagan delivered that day is considered by many to have affirmed the beginning of the end of the Cold War and the fall of communism. On Nov. 9-11, 1989, the people of a free Berlin tore down that wall.
“General Secretary Gorbachev, if you seek peace, if you seek prosperity for the Soviet Union and Eastern Europe, if you seek liberalization: Come here to this gate! Mr. Gorbachev, open this gate! Mr. Gorbachev, tear down this wall!’”
